The Judaica Institute (JI) is the place to be on Wednesday nights! It’s where an exciting social and educational program awaits you. JI is open to all Jewish Teenagers living in the Greater Palm Beaches who are in 8th through 12th grade.

JI is more than just classes. JI is about being with friends, learning new things, and making a difference. From the moment you enter the JCC to when it’s time to go home, you’re in store for an incredible experience every week.
 
Here is what you can expect on a regular night at JI:
 
5:30-6:00 p.m.  Light dinner (optional)
6:00-6:50 p.m.  1st Hour
6:50-7:10 p.m.  Break
7:10-8:00 p.m.  2nd Hour
